March 5, 2002
The Arizona State men's golf team is tied for seventh with a 30-over 598 after 36 holes at the USC Cleveland Golf Classic held at North Ranch Country Club in Westlake Village, Calif. For live scoring, go to http://www.golfstat.com.
Arizona State shot 311-287=598 on the par-71 course and is tied with New Mexico. Host USC leads the event with a 13-over 581. ASU is the two-time defending champion of the event.
